What Are Skull Base Tumors?
A skull base tumor forms near the bottom part of the skull and can come from different tissues like nerves, glands, or bones. Tumors in this region include:
Because of where they are located, these tumors can be hard to reach. Even if they are not cancerous, they can press on important nerves or brain structures, leading to serious symptoms.
Symptoms of Skull Base Tumor
Symptoms vary based on tumor size and position but may include:
Ongoing headaches that don’t go away
Numbness or weakness in the face
Changes in hearing or blurred vision
Blocked nose or frequent nosebleeds
Feeling dizzy or losing balance often
Trouble speaking or swallowing

Diagnosis of Skull Base Tumor
Accurate skull base tumor diagnosis is the key to successful treatment. A detailed evaluation includes:
MRI or CT scans to identify the size, type, and spread
Endoscopy for tumors in sinus or nasal areas
Biopsy to confirm if the tumor is benign or malignant
Neurological exams to assess nerve function and impact
These tests help create a tailored treatment plan based on the tumor’s behavior and location.
Treatment Options for Skull Base Tumors
The choice of skull base tumor treatment depends on the tumor type, size, location, and overall health of the patient. Treatment may involve one or more of the following:
1. Skull Base Tumor Surgery
Surgery is often the first-line treatment. Types include:
Endoscopic skull base surgery – performed through the nose with no external cuts
Open skull base surgery – used for deep or large tumors requiring wider access
Microsurgery – protects surrounding nerves and brain structures
The goal is to remove the tumor while preserving important neurological functions.
2. Radiation Therapy
Used when:
The tumor cannot be fully removed
As a post-surgical option to destroy remaining cancer cells
For recurrent or high-grade tumors
Techniques like Gamma Knife or CyberKnife radiosurgery offer targeted therapy with minimal side effects.
3. Chemotherapy & Targeted Therapy
Chemotherapy may be used for aggressive or malignant skull base tumors. Some tumors respond well to targeted drugs based on genetic markers, which helps reduce damage to healthy tissues.
Living After Skull Base Tumor Treatment
Recovery depends on the complexity of surgery and the tumor’s effect on nerves. Post-treatment care may include:
Speech and physical therapy
Pain and nerve function management
Regular MRI/CT follow-ups
Nutritional and psychological support
Early intervention and a supportive care team improve both survival and quality of life.
